β¦ Synopsis
Textured YBCO samples were produced following the partial-melt method with sample transport. Structural and compositional characterizations, performed by means of XRD and SEM/EDS, show the presence of the 123 with a small amount of 211 inclusions. The investigated samples show a non weak link behaviour in the irreversible magnetic properties at 77 K, with critical current densities Jc = 104 A/c m2 at 2 kOe.
